3、OSI各層概述
物理層:是OSI的最低層,是網(wǎng)絡(luò)物理設(shè)備之間的接口,目的是在通信設(shè)備DTE/DCE之間提供透明的比特流傳輸。
DTE 數(shù)據(jù)終端設(shè)備指計算機網(wǎng)絡(luò)中用于處理用戶數(shù)據(jù)的設(shè)備,是計算機網(wǎng)絡(luò)的數(shù)據(jù)信源和信宿。 DCE 數(shù)據(jù)電路端接設(shè)備:它介于DTE與網(wǎng)絡(luò)中傳輸介質(zhì)之間的設(shè)備。
物理層提供的服務(wù):a、物理連接。b、物理服務(wù)數(shù)據(jù)單元。c、順序化:接收物理實體收到的比特順序,與發(fā)送物理實體所發(fā)送的比特順序相同。d、數(shù)據(jù)電路標識。
數(shù)據(jù)鏈路層:主要用途是為在相鄰網(wǎng)絡(luò)實體之間建立、維持和釋放數(shù)據(jù)鏈路連接,以及傳輸數(shù)據(jù)鏈路服務(wù)數(shù)據(jù)單元。 數(shù)據(jù)鏈路層的功能: a、數(shù)據(jù)鏈路連接的建立與釋放。b、構(gòu)成數(shù)據(jù)鏈路數(shù)據(jù)單元。c、數(shù)據(jù)鏈路連接的分裂。d、定界與同步。e、順序和流量控制。f、差錯的檢測和恢復(fù)。 數(shù)據(jù)鏈路層協(xié)議: 面向字符的通信規(guī)程和面向比特的通信規(guī)程。高級數(shù)據(jù)鏈路控制規(guī)程HDLC是典型的面向比特的通信規(guī)程。
網(wǎng)絡(luò)層:以數(shù)據(jù)鏈路層提供的無差錯傳輸為基礎(chǔ),為實現(xiàn)源DCE和目標DCE之間的通信而建立、維持和終止網(wǎng)絡(luò)連接,并通過網(wǎng)絡(luò)連接交換網(wǎng)絡(luò)服務(wù)數(shù)據(jù)單元。它 主要解決 數(shù)據(jù)傳輸單元分組在通信子網(wǎng)中的路由選擇、擁塞控制問題以及多個網(wǎng)絡(luò)互聯(lián)的問題。 網(wǎng)絡(luò)層的功能: a、建立和拆除網(wǎng)絡(luò)連接。b、路徑選擇和中繼。c、網(wǎng)絡(luò)連接多路復(fù)用。d、分段和組塊。e、服務(wù)選擇。f、傳輸和流量控制。網(wǎng)絡(luò)層的服務(wù):數(shù)據(jù)報服務(wù)和虛電路服務(wù)。 路由選擇算法的要求: 正確性,簡單性,健壯性,穩(wěn)定性,公平性和最優(yōu)化。
虛電路和數(shù)據(jù)報的比較 項 目 虛 電 路 數(shù) 據(jù) 報 目標地址 僅建立連接時需要 每個分組都需要 初始化設(shè)置 需要 不需要 分組順序 由通信子網(wǎng)負責按序到達 不保證 差錯控制 由通信子網(wǎng)負責 由主機負責 流量控制 通信子網(wǎng)提供 網(wǎng)絡(luò)層不提供 連接的建立和釋放 需要 不需要
傳輸層: 是資源子網(wǎng)與通信子網(wǎng)的界面與橋梁 ,它完成資源子網(wǎng)中兩結(jié)點間的邏輯通信,實現(xiàn)通信子網(wǎng)中端到端的透明傳輸。傳輸層的功能:a、映象傳輸?shù)刂返骄W(wǎng)絡(luò)地址。b、多路復(fù)用與分割。c、傳輸連接的建立與釋放。d、分段與重新組裝。e、組塊與分塊。 網(wǎng)絡(luò)層 服務(wù)可分成三類:A類:網(wǎng)絡(luò)連接具有可接受的差錯率和可接受的故障通知率,A類服務(wù)是可靠的網(wǎng)絡(luò)服務(wù),一般指虛電路服務(wù)。C類:網(wǎng)絡(luò)連接具有不可接受的差錯率,C類的服務(wù)質(zhì)量最差,提供數(shù)據(jù)報服務(wù)或無線電分組交換網(wǎng)均屬此類。B類:網(wǎng)絡(luò)連接具有可接受的差錯率和不可接受的故障通知率,B類服務(wù)介于前二者之間,廣域網(wǎng)多提供B類服務(wù)。根據(jù)不同的網(wǎng)絡(luò)層服務(wù), 傳輸層協(xié)議 分為0-4五類。
會話層:它利用傳輸層提供的端到端數(shù)據(jù)傳輸服務(wù),具體實施服務(wù)請求者與服務(wù)提供者之間的通信,屬于進程間通信范疇。會話層的功能:a、會話連接到傳輸連接的映射。b、數(shù)據(jù)傳送。c、會話連接的恢復(fù)和釋放。d、會話管理。e、令牌管理。f、活動管理。
表示層:目的是處理有關(guān)被傳送數(shù)據(jù)的表示問題。對通信雙方的計算機來說,一般有其自已的數(shù)據(jù)內(nèi)部表示方式,表示層的任務(wù)是把發(fā)送方具有的內(nèi)部格式結(jié)構(gòu)編碼為適合傳輸?shù)奈涣,然后在目的端將其解碼為所需的表示。表示層的功能:數(shù)據(jù)語法轉(zhuǎn)換、語法表示、表示連接管理、數(shù)據(jù)加密和數(shù)據(jù)壓縮。
應(yīng)用層:它是OSI/RM的最高層,是直接面向用戶的一層,是計算機網(wǎng)絡(luò)與最終用戶間的界面。 目的是作為用戶使用OSI功能的唯一窗口。 從功能劃分看,OSI的下面6層協(xié)議解決了支持網(wǎng)絡(luò)服務(wù)功能所需的通信和表示問題,而應(yīng)用層則提供完成特定網(wǎng)絡(luò)服務(wù)功能所需的各種應(yīng)用協(xié)議。應(yīng)用進程借助于應(yīng)用實體(AE)、使用協(xié)議和表示服務(wù)來交換信息。應(yīng)用實體由一個用戶元素UE和一些應(yīng)用服務(wù)元素組成。UE是于用戶有關(guān)的一組元素。
4、其他網(wǎng)絡(luò)系統(tǒng)結(jié)構(gòu)
ARPA網(wǎng)的體系結(jié)構(gòu):是一個成功的分組交換網(wǎng),是世界上最早的廣域計算機網(wǎng)絡(luò)。由主機、接口信件處理機IMP、終端接口處理機TIP組成。書上第139業(yè)圖5.15中:虛線表示虛擬通信,實線表示實際通信。
NetWare網(wǎng)的體系結(jié)構(gòu):傳輸介質(zhì)層、互聯(lián)網(wǎng)層、傳輸層、應(yīng)用層。(在NetWare網(wǎng)中要重點注意IPX協(xié)議、SPX協(xié)議。)
NT的體系結(jié)構(gòu):NT網(wǎng)絡(luò)的基礎(chǔ)是網(wǎng)絡(luò)設(shè)備接口規(guī)范NDIS 4.0設(shè)備驅(qū)動程序。NDIS定義了一個數(shù)據(jù)鏈路層接口,使多網(wǎng)絡(luò)層協(xié)議能在同一時間訪問同一網(wǎng)卡。NT中的傳輸協(xié)議:NWlink:是與NetWare IPX/SPX兼容的通信協(xié)議,通過NT中提供的網(wǎng)關(guān)程序,能訪問NetWare網(wǎng)絡(luò)上的資源。TCP/IP:是目前最完整、最普遍接受的通信協(xié)議標準,它可讓不同硬件結(jié)構(gòu)、不同操作系統(tǒng)的計算機之間通信。NetBEUI:在小型網(wǎng)絡(luò)上是最快、最有效的通信協(xié)議,但沒有路由功能,在廣域網(wǎng)上效率較低。DLC:數(shù)據(jù)鏈路控制協(xié)議,讓NT計算機與大型計算機聯(lián)網(wǎng),或連接網(wǎng)絡(luò)打印機、使用遠程啟動服務(wù)時必須安裝的協(xié)議。
相關(guān)推薦:北京 | 天津 | 上海 | 江蘇 | 山東 |
安徽 | 浙江 | 江西 | 福建 | 深圳 |
廣東 | 河北 | 湖南 | 廣西 | 河南 |
海南 | 湖北 | 四川 | 重慶 | 云南 |
貴州 | 西藏 | 新疆 | 陜西 | 山西 |
寧夏 | 甘肅 | 青海 | 遼寧 | 吉林 |
黑龍江 | 內(nèi)蒙古 |